FIN. <br />BUILDING PAPER <br />WIRE LATH <br />Q <br />0 <br />Q <br />0 <br />10 <br />Water Resistant Barrier <br />Lath <br />Sheathing <br />Stucco <br />FLASHING REQUIREMENTS <br />R609.1 Flashing, Sealants and Weatherstripping. Flashing and sealants for exterior windows shall comply with Section R703.8. <br />R703.2 Weather -resistant sheathing paper. One layer of No.1 5 asphalt felt, free from holes and breaks, complying with ASTM D 226 for Type 1 feIt or <br />other approved water -resistive barrier shall be applied over studs or sheathing of all exterior walls. Such felt or material shall be applied horizontally, <br />with the upper layer lapped over the lower layer not less than 2 inches (51 mm). Where joints occur, felt shall be lapped not less than 6 inches (152 <br />mm). The felt or other approved material shall be continuous to the top of walls and terminated at penetrations and building appendages in a manner <br />to meet the requirements of the exterior wall envelope as described in Section R703.4 <br />Exception: Omission of the water -resistive barrier is permitted in the following situations: <br />1. In detached accessory buildings. <br />2. Under exterior wall finish materials as permitted in Table R703.4 <br />3. Under Paperbacked stucco lath when the paper backing is an approved water -resistive barrier. <br />R703.4 Flashing. Approved corrosion -resistant flashing shall be applied shingle -fashion in a manner to prevent entry of water into thewall cavity or <br />penetration of water to the building structural framing components. Self -adhered membranes used as flashing shall comply with AAMA 711. The <br />flashing shall extend to the surface of the exterior wall finish. Approved corrosion -resistant flashings shall be installed at all of the following locations: <br />1. Exterior window and door openings. Flashing at exterior Window and door openings shall extend to the surface ot he exterior wall finish or to the <br />water -resistive barrier for subsequent drainage. Flashing at exterior window and door openings shall be installed in accordance with one or more of the <br />following or other approved method: <br />1, 1 The fenestration manufacturer's written flashing instructions. <br />1.2 The flashing manufacturer's written installation instructions. <br />1.3 In accordance with FMA/AAMA 100, FMA/AAMA 200, or FMAIWDMA 250. <br />1.4 In accordance with the flashing method of a registered design professional. <br />2. At the intersection of chimneys or other masonry construction with frame or stucco walls, with projecting lips on both sides under stucco copings. <br />3. Under and at the ends of masonry, wood or metal copings and sills. <br />4. Continuously above all projecting wood trim. <br />5. Where exterior porches, decks or stairs attach to a wall or floor assembly of wood -frame construction, <br />6. At wall and roof intersections. <br />7. At built-in gutters. <br />R703.6.2.1 Weep Screeds <br />A Minimum 0.01 9-inch (No. 26 GaIv. sheet gage), corrosion -resistant weep screed or plastic weep screed, with a minimum vertical attachment flange of <br />3 1/2" shall be provided at or below the foundation plate line on exterior stud walls in accordance with ASTM C 926. <br />SELF -ADHERED FLASHING <br />PRODUCTS DETAILS <br />TWO LAYERS OF FELT OR ONE LAYER OF HOUSE WRAP AND <br />ONE LAYER OF FELT ARE REQUIRED BEHIND STUCCO.
